French-Spanish Legal Dictionary

The French- Spanish legal dictionary provides the translation of over 2,500 legal terms and expressions from French to Spanish and vice versa and an update of the legal issues in Spain.

Read more

Logo vertical | Mariscal & Abogados

On air tonight: a Spanish lawyer on TV

Mariscal Abogados received an invitation to provide insights on a prominent television program in Spain. The focus of the discussion was the contentious and sensitive topic of granting citizenship to investors in select European Union countries.

Read more